Comprehensive Service Overview

In Saragosa, pest control efforts focus on the realities of desert living, where pests like scorpions, ants, and rodents are year-round concerns but ramp up in summer heat. Homeowners and property managers typically begin with an inspection to identify the pest type, entry points, and attracting conditions—think cracks in foundations dried by the sun or moisture pockets from AC units.

From there, integrated pest management (IPM) is common, combining targeted treatments with prevention: sealing gaps, reducing clutter, and controlling moisture to keep invaders out. Treatments use precision applications that minimize exposure for families, pets, and businesses, often low-odor options safe for indoor spaces like restaurants or homes.

Expect a custom treatment plan outlining steps, with follow-up visits for monitoring tougher issues like bed bugs or termite colonies. Prevention tips include yard maintenance to deter mosquitoes and regular checks in garages for spiders. Same-week response helps stop spreads early, and ongoing service ensures lasting results tailored to our arid climate—no one-size-fits-all here.

Regional Characteristics

Saragosa sits in the heart of the Chihuahuan Desert, with scorching summers, mild winters, and very low rainfall—about 10 inches a year. Housing mixes older ranch-style homes with single-story builds and some newer modular setups on larger lots. Low population density means more open spaces around properties, but proximity to oil fields and arid scrubland influences pest patterns. Sparse vegetation and rocky soil make for dry conditions, though occasional monsoons can bring temporary moisture spikes.

Common Issues

Residents frequently spot scorpions hiding under rocks or in garages, fire ants building mounds in yards, rodents seeking shelter in attics, and spiders weaving webs in corners. Roaches pop up in kitchens, termites target older wooden structures, and mosquitoes breed near any standing water from irrigation or rare rains. Seasonality peaks in warmer months, with infestations spreading quickly in the heat.
